Can you cook frozen chicken?
According to the USDA, yes, you can safely cook your frozen chicken, as long as you follow a couple general guidelines. In order to skip the thawing step and turn your frozen chicken into a fully-cooked, safe-to-eat dinner, use your oven or stove top and simply increase your cooking time by at least 50%.
How do you cook frozen skinless chicken breast?
Preheat oven to 400 degrees F. Place frozen chicken breasts in a large baking dish so that they aren't overlapping. Cover with foil or a lid and bake for 20 minutes.
How long does it take for chicken to defrost?
Depending on which method you use, chicken can take anywhere from 2 days to 30 minutes to thaw. The refrigerator method can take up to 2 days, depending on how many lbs of frozen chicken breast you have. The cold water method takes up to 1 hour per pound.
What is the proper way to defrost chicken?
Thawing chicken in the fridge is the best and safest way to defrost it, but it requires about a day of planning ahead, so if you need a faster solution, skip ahead. The day before you plan to cook your chicken, transfer it from the freezer to the fridge to let it thaw slowly, for at least 24 hours.

Can I defrost chicken in cold water without packaging?
Can I defrost meat in water without a bag? While it is possible to defrost meat in water without a bag, it isn't recommended. The problem is that the meat will absorb some of the water and will likely become waterlogged.
